- When 16-year-old Glory, Tresa Fischer's wild-child younger sister, turns up dead on a beach near Mark and Hilary's Florida hotel, Mark becomes the number one murder suspect. Det. Cab Bolton, who isn't one to jump to conclusions, travels from Florida to Wisconsin to unravel Mark--and Glory's--complicated lives.
